Weatherproof

Most Common

Weatherproofing in construction is a critical process that ensures buildings and structures are protected against the elements, such as rain, snow, wind, and UV radiation. This protection is achieved through the use of durable materials and construction techniques that prevent water ingress and thermal bridging. Effective weatherproofing contributes to the structural integrity of buildings, reducing maintenance costs and enhancing occupant comfort.

The selection of weatherproofing materials and methods is influenced by the building's location, design, and intended use. Advances in technology have introduced more efficient and sustainable options, allowing for better performance and environmental compatibility. Proper weatherproofing is essential for meeting building codes and standards, underscoring its significance in the construction industry's commitment to quality and safety.

Working Pressure

In the construction industry, 'Working Pressure' refers to the maximum pressure that a system or component is designed to handle under normal operating conditions. This measurement is crucial for ensuring the safety and efficiency of pipelines, boilers, and other pressure vessels. It is determined by engineering standards and must be strictly adhered to to prevent failures or accidents.

Understanding and applying the correct working pressure is essential for construction professionals, as it directly impacts the durability and reliability of the infrastructure. Materials and designs are selected based on these pressures to withstand the expected loads without degradation over time. Regular inspections and maintenance are conducted to ensure that the systems continue to operate within their designated working pressures.

Waterproof

Waterproofing in construction involves applying materials and techniques to prevent water from penetrating buildings or structures. This process is vital for protecting the integrity of the construction and preventing damage such as mold growth, structural weakening, and aesthetic deterioration. Various methods, including membranes, coatings, and sealants, are used to achieve waterproofing based on the specific requirements of the project.

The choice of waterproofing method depends on factors like the building's location, the materials used, and the expected exposure to water. Effective waterproofing extends the lifespan of a structure and reduces maintenance costs. It is a critical consideration in areas prone to heavy rainfall or high humidity, ensuring that buildings remain safe, comfortable, and dry for their occupants.
